
On the photowalk the Nikon D60 became a fairly big subject, and people were talking about buying one and talking about what lenses were available for them.
One thing you should remember when/if buying a Nikon D60 is that it does not have a built-in focus-motor like some other Nikon models (D50, D80, D300 and some others...i dont remember them all)
So it's not all lenses that would "work" on the D60 - or...they will work...but you would have to adjust the focus manually (and trust me...you dont want that all the time) so i promised to find a list of compatible lenses that would have a built-in focus-motor.

This is a complete list, and some various info about the lenses in general, but the main thing to remember is that you need to look for the "AF-S" name in the lens.
